After 6000 miles with no problems (other than the hard ride from the run flat tires), I can say it is just an incredible vehicle that is exciting every time I get in it.

I don't and never will love the iDrive system or the navigation but it's livable.

It gets very positive attention, much more than I expected..

I love it.
